Sadie Sink, best known for her role in Stranger Things, is set to join Tom Holland in the next Spider-Man film. Production kicks off later this year, with Destin Daniel Cretton directing and Marvel Studios teaming up with Sony once again. While the actress’s character remains a mystery, fans are buzzing about the possibility of her playing Jean Grey or another iconic redhead from Spidey’s world.

With Tom Holland wrapping up The Odyssey for Christopher Nolan, all eyes are on his return as Spider-Man. The new installment is set to introduce new faces, meaning Sadie Sink’s character could play a crucial role in Peter Parker’s evolving story.

Meanwhile, the former child actor’s schedule is packed—she just finished filming the final season of Stranger Things (dropping later this year) and is set to star in O’Dessa, which hits Hulu next week. Before joining Tom Holland, Sadie Sink will also take the Broadway stage in John Proctor Is the Villain, premiering April 4, 2025.
